Reilly, Edward John was born on April 2, 1923 in Syracuse, New York, United States. Son of John Paul and Margaret (Shamock) Reilly.
Bachelor, St. Bonaventure University, 1949. Postgraduate, Fordham University, 1951.
Director information, National Fire Sprinkler Association, New York City, 1956-1970; vice president, National Fire Sprinkler Association, Mount Kisco, New York, 1970-1977; executive vice president, National Fire Sprinkler Association, Paterson, New York, 1976-1977; president, National Fire Sprinkler Association, Patterson, New York, 1977-1985; retired, National Fire Sprinkler Association, Patterson, New York, 1985; president, Ed Reilly Associations, Kinderhook, New York, since 1985.
Captain Republican National Committee, New York City, 1949-1952, leader Republican Bronx election campaign, 1950-1951. Member 8th Air Force History Society. Trustee Kinderhook Memorial Library.
With United States Army Air Force, 1943-1945. Member Full Gospel Businessmen's Fellowship International, American Legion (chapter vice Commander 1950-1951).
Married Marjorie Helen Cook, January 29, 1949. Children: Maureen Ann, Patrick Brian, Thomas Kevin, Timothy John, Dennis Edward, Daniel Lawrence.
